How Much Does It Cost to Build a Home in Los Angeles?

Building a new home in Los Angeles involves a complex financial landscape. The city’s unique market dynamics, including high demand, limited space, and stringent regulations, contribute to elevated construction expenses. Understanding the various cost components is fundamental for prospective homeowners to establish a realistic budget.
Direct construction expenses, or “hard costs,” are the largest portion of a new home’s total cost, influenced by material choices, labor rates, and design complexity. In Los Angeles, average costs range from $400 to $500 per square foot, extending from $300 to over $800 per square foot depending on customization and location. A 2,500 square foot home could have hard costs from $500,000 to over $1.6 million.
Foundation and framing form the structural backbone; costs are influenced by site conditions and design. Foundation work, including excavation and concrete pouring, can cost $4 to $25 per square foot. Flat lots are less expensive than hillsides requiring extensive grading and retaining walls. Framing, the house’s skeleton, uses lumber and other structural materials; prices fluctuate based on market demand.
Exterior finishes, including roofing, siding, windows, and doors, provide the home’s protective shell and aesthetic appeal. Material selection, from asphalt shingles to tile roofs or stucco to stone siding, directly impacts costs. Energy-efficient windows and custom doors also contribute to expense, reflecting material and installation labor. These components are essential for weatherproofing, insulation, and long-term performance.
Interior finishes transform the framed structure into a livable space, covering drywall, flooring, cabinetry, countertops, fixtures, and painting. While basic materials like drywall and lumber have consistent costs, finish choices introduce wide variations. Custom cabinetry and high-end tile or exotic flooring significantly increase expenses compared to pre-fabricated alternatives and standard finishes. Appliances, specialized fixtures, and detailed elements like wainscoting or coffered ceilings also contribute to the final interior cost.
Mechanical, electrical, and plumbing (MEP) systems are complex and represent a substantial portion of direct construction costs, ensuring functionality and comfort. This includes heating, ventilation, and air conditioning (HVAC) systems, designed based on home size and climate. Electrical wiring, panels, and outlets must meet safety codes and accommodate modern power demands. Plumbing involves installing water supply lines, drainage systems, and fixtures.
Labor costs are a significant factor in Los Angeles, often 30% to 60% of the total construction budget. The high cost of living contributes to elevated wages for skilled tradespeople, including electricians, plumbers, and carpenters. Specialized trades command higher rates, with electricians charging $45-$75 per hour and plumbers $50-$85 per hour. Demand for skilled workers and architectural design complexity also influence labor expenses.
Site acquisition and development costs encompass all expenditures related to securing and preparing the land before physical construction begins. These initial investments are highly variable, especially in Los Angeles. The land purchase price is often the most substantial single expense, with residential land in Los Angeles being among the most expensive due to limited availability and high demand. Land costs can range from $100 to over $500 per square foot, depending on location and desirability.
If an existing structure occupies the site, demolition and debris removal become necessary. Demolition costs vary widely, influenced by the existing structure’s size and type, and the amount of material to be hauled away. While costs can be substantial, homes affected by wildfires might require less demolition, potentially reducing expenses. Proper disposal of demolition waste, often requiring specific environmental protocols, adds to the cost.
Site clearing and grading involve preparing the land for construction, including removing vegetation, rocks, and debris, and leveling the terrain. This process is important on uneven or sloped lots, common in Los Angeles, where extensive excavation and earthmoving may be required. Such work can necessitate retaining walls or specialized drainage systems, significantly increasing preparation costs. The land’s geological characteristics, such as soil stability and proximity to fault lines, also influence the complexity and expense of site work.
Utility connections are another substantial development cost, ensuring access to essential services like water, sewer, gas, and electricity. These expenses include physical installation of lines from the main grid to the property, and connection fees charged by utility providers. Trenching may be required to lay these lines underground, adding to labor and equipment costs. Distance from existing utility infrastructure can also influence the total expenditure for these services.
Soil testing and geotechnical reports are crucial preparatory surveys, especially in seismically active Los Angeles. These reports assess soil composition, stability, and load-bearing capacity, identifying potential issues like expansive clays or liquefaction risks. Findings from these tests dictate the foundation type and can lead to additional costs for soil remediation or specialized engineering designs. These reports are often mandatory for permitting and ensure the structural integrity and safety of the future home.
Professional services and regulatory charges, or “soft costs,” are essential for a home construction project in Los Angeles, though they do not involve physical labor on site. These fees ensure project compliance with local codes, safety standards, and design specifications. Architectural and design fees are a primary component, covering blueprints, structural plans, and potentially interior design concepts. These fees range from $20,000 to over $100,000, depending on home complexity and customization.
Engineering fees encompass structural, civil, and sometimes specialized engineering disciplines. Structural engineers ensure the building’s integrity and compliance with seismic codes, which are stringent in Los Angeles. Civil engineers address site-specific challenges like drainage, grading, and utility connections. These services are indispensable for securing permits and ensuring the long-term safety and stability of the residence.
Permit fees represent a significant regulatory charge, covering various approvals required by local authorities. These include building permits, zoning approvals, and environmental clearances, all of which can be substantial. Obtaining these permits can be lengthy and complex, with fees varying based on project size, scope, and specific requirements. Navigating the municipal plan check process for designs and permits also contributes to cost and timeline.
Impact fees are additional charges imposed by local authorities to offset the burden new construction places on public services and infrastructure. These fees can fund schools, traffic mitigation, parks, and other community resources. Impact fees vary widely depending on the jurisdiction within Los Angeles and the proposed home’s size and type. These fees are a mandatory cost that must be factored into the project budget.
Surveying costs are necessary to delineate property boundaries and prepare detailed site plans. Beyond initial geotechnical reports, boundary surveys confirm property lines, easements, and setbacks, crucial for design and construction accuracy. Topographic surveys map land contours, providing essential information for grading and drainage plans. These surveys prevent disputes and ensure construction adheres to legal property limits and local regulations.
Project overhead and contingencies cover indirect and unforeseen costs during a home building project, serving as financial buffers. Construction loan interest and fees are a significant component if financed. Interest accrues on the drawn portion of the loan throughout construction, rather than on the full amount upfront. Lenders may also charge origination fees, appraisal fees, and other closing costs associated with securing construction financing.
Builder’s risk insurance is a specialized policy protecting the construction project from various perils during the building phase. This coverage includes damage from fire, theft, vandalism, and natural disasters. Given the substantial investment in materials and labor, this insurance safeguards against financial losses that could halt or delay the project. Premiums for this policy are an essential part of project overhead.
Property taxes continue to be an expense during construction, based on the assessed value of the land or any existing structure. While the property is under construction and not yet fully assessed as a completed home, owners are still responsible for these tax obligations. These taxes are an operating cost that must be accounted for in financial planning, independent of construction progress.
Temporary utilities are necessary to support on-site construction, including temporary power for tools and equipment, water for mixing materials and cleaning, and waste disposal services. These temporary services often require separate hook-ups and recurring charges. Managing construction debris and waste removal is a continuous process throughout the build, incurring costs for dumpsters and hauling services. These operational expenses ensure a functional and safe work environment.
A contingency fund is the most important financial provision for any home building project, especially in Los Angeles. It represents 10% to 20% of the total estimated project cost and covers unforeseen expenses, design changes, or delays. Unpredictable issues, such as unexpected soil conditions, material price fluctuations, or regulatory changes, can arise, making a contingency fund indispensable for maintaining project momentum and avoiding budget overruns.
